Passive House Design Explained: The Complete Building Guide Passive House design is a way to build homes that use much less energy while staying comfortable all year. It focuses on five key principles: - Superinsulation: Thick insulation keeps homes warm in winter and cool in summer. - Airtight Construction: Sealing gaps and cracks prevents energy loss. - High-Performance Windows/Doors: Advanced materials reduce heat loss and drafts. - Thermal Bridge-Free Design: Eliminates weak spots where heat escapes. - Ventilation with Heat Recovery (HRV/ERV): Maintains fresh air while saving energy. Key Benefits: - Energy Savings: Annual heating costs as low as $100-$300 for a 2,000 sq. ft. home -- up to 90% less than standard homes. - Comfort: Consistent indoor temperatures with no drafts or hotspots. - Healthier Air: Continuous ventilation filters out pollutants and allergens. - Eco-Friendly: Cuts carbon emissions by 60-80%.
